Abstract
Allergic contact dermatitis has been established as the most frequent cause of eyelid dermatitis, but it is often misdiagnosed. The purpose of this study was to evaluate the characteristics of patients with eyelid dermatitis who were referred for patch testing. The patients were divided into three subgroups in this retrospective study: patients with only eyelid involvement, patients with involvement of eyelids and other areas, and patients without eyelid involvement. Data was collected on diagnoses, medical history, personal care products and make-up use, occupational dermatitis, and positive allergens. An independent t-test, one-way ANOVA, and chi-squared test were used to analyze the data. A total of 427 patients who referred for patch tests were included in the study. Of these, 139 patients had eyelid dermatitis. Allergic contact dermatitis (ACD) was the most common diagnosis in all three groups referred for patch tests. Use of shaving cream and hair conditioner was significantly higher in patients with only eyelid involvement and nickel sulfate was the most common allergen among them. Patch testing is the gold standard tool in the evaluation of eyelid contact dermatitis, and it is a necessity in the treatment of eyelid dermatitis, for the accurate identification of responsible allergens.

Abstract
Eczematous diseases (contact dermatitis, atopic dermatitis, hand eczema) are among the most frequent findings in dermatological clinical practice. A large body of evidence exists on structural and functional skin barrier damage in eczematous diseases, and on the importance of interventions aimed to repair such damage. While there is substantial agreement on pharmacological treatment, more sparse data are available on role, indications and usefulness of topical non-pharmacological treatments, despite significant research and progress in the composition and technology of emollients, cleansers and barrier creams significantly changed and expanded the functional activities of these products. This often leads to inadequate prescription and/or use, which increase individual and social costs of the disease and make the products useless or, in some cases, even counterproductive. This consensus document, discussed and compiled in a series of meetings by a group of Italian dermatologists experienced in the field of eczematous diseases, summarizes epidemiology and clinical features of the nosological entities of the "eczema family", illustrates the chemical/biochemical structure of emollients, cleansers and barrier creams, and aims to help physicians to exploit the full potential of available products, by providing a detailed but practical guide on characteristics, indications and correct use of non-pharmacological treatments currently available for eczematous diseases.

Abstract
PURPOSE OF REVIEW Occupational allergic diseases (OAD) such as occupational contact dermatitis (OCD), occupational asthma (OA), and occupational rhinitis (OR) are the most prevalent occupational diseases in industrialized countries. The purpose of this review is to provide an update about the main occupational metal and solvent exposures related to allergy and airway diseases and to discuss newly defined causative agents and industries in this field. RECENT FINDINGS Currently for over 400 causative agents for OA and OCD, several hundreds of agents for OR have been identified. Although many studies have reported an overall decline in OAD related to known agents after implementation of efficient and effective workplace preventive measures, the constant development of new products continuously introduces to the market potential unknown respiratory hazards. Workplace allergens are often high molecular weight (HMW) agents that are > 10 kDa molecular weight and capable of eliciting IgE sensitization. Sensitizing low molecular weight (LMW) agents are often reactive chemicals. Metals and solvents are two large causative agent groups related to OADs that mainly behave as LMW (< 10 kDa) sensitizers and/or irritants. Avoidance of causative exposures through control strategies is the primary prevention approach for OADs. These strategies must be applied and covered for all known and newly defined causative agents. This review aims to summarize current status of known occupational metal and solvent exposures related to allergy and airway diseases and to discuss newly defined causative agents and industries in this field.

Abstract
BACKGROUND Irritant contact dermatitis (ICD) is a common diagnosis in patients with occupational contact dermatitis (OCD). Studies are lacking on the usefulness of material safety data sheets (MSDSs) in making the diagnosis of ICD. OBJECTIVE To characterize irritant exposures leading to the diagnosis of occupational ICD (OICD), and to evaluate the occurrence of concomitant exposures to contact allergens. METHODS We included 316 patients with suspected occupational hand dermatitis, referred to the Department of Dermato-Allergology, Copenhagen University Hospital Gentofte, Denmark during January 2010-August 2011, in a programme consisting of a clinical examination, exposure assessment, and extensive patch/prick testing. RESULTS OCD was diagnosed in 228 patients. Of these patients, 118 were diagnosed with OICD. The main irritant exposures identified were wet work (n = 64), gloves (n = 45), mechanical traumas (n = 19), and oils (n = 15). Exposure to specific irritant chemicals was found in 9 patients, and was identified from MSDSs/ingredients labelling in 8 of these patients. Review of MSDSs and ingredients labelling showed that 41 patients were exposed to 41 moderate to potent contact allergens, and 18 patients were exposed to 25 weak workplace contact allergens. CONCLUSION In the present study, the systematic exposure assessment did not reveal any new irritants. MSDSs have a limited role in the investigation of ICD.

Abstract
BACKGROUND The diagnosis of combined allergic and irritant contact dermatitis is an accepted subdiagnosis for hand dermatitis, and it is often considered in a patient with contact dermatitis, a positive and relevant patch test result, and wet work exposure. We therefore hypothesize that it is arbitrary for wet work exposure to be taken into consideration in a patient with newly diagnosed relevant contact allergy. Furthermore, an overestimation of the diagnosis will probably occur if the criteria for wet work exposure are applied correctly, as many occupations have an element of wet work. OBJECTIVES To find the statistically expected number of combined allergic and irritant contact dermatitis cases in 1000 patients, and to evaluate the diagnostic criteria for the diagnosis. METHODS One thousand consecutive patients with occupational contact dermatitis from a hospital unit in Denmark were assessed. RESULTS The expected number of cases with the diagnosis of combined allergic and irritant contact dermatitis was 0.33%, as compared with the observed number of 6.4%. Females occupied in wet occupations were often diagnosed with combined allergic and irritant contact dermatitis (p < 0.005). CONCLUSION The diagnosis of combined allergic and irritant contact dermatitis should be used critically to avoid misclassification, and possible criteria for the diagnosis are proposed.

Abstract
BACKGROUND Classification of hand eczema has traditionally been based both on aetiology and clinical appearance. For 20% of cases, the aetiology is unknown. OBJECTIVES To suggest a classification based on well-defined aetiology as well as on predefined clinical patterns and on the dynamics of hand eczema. METHODS Literature studies and discussions among members of the Danish Contact Dermatitis Group. RESULTS Criteria are given for the aetiological diagnoses of allergic contact dermatitis of the hands, irritant contact dermatitis of the hands, protein contact dermatitis of the hands, atopic hand eczema and aetiologically unclassifiable hand eczema. Six different clinical patterns are described and illustrated. Suggestions for general treatment principles are given. CONCLUSION Operational guidelines for the diagnosis and treatment of hand eczema are described.
